Proposed Lobbying Suspension

Posted on December 8, 2008 by Eric Brown

In Massachusetts, Sec. of State Galvin has proposed suspending certain lobbyists. Secretary of State William Galvin, frustrated by the refusal of Cognos ULC and its lobbyist, Richard McDonough, to detail his lobbying efforts while the software company was seeking state … Continue reading →
